/openjdk7/jdk/src/share/native/sun/font/layout/ |
H A D | LigatureSubstitution.h | 57 le_uint32 ligActionOffset; 58 le_uint32 componentOffset; 59 le_uint32 ligatureOffset; 81 typedef le_uint32 LigatureActionEntry;
|
H A D | ExtensionSubtables.h | 53 le_uint32 extensionOffset; 55 le_uint32 process(const LEReferenceTo<ExtensionSubtable> &extRef,
|
H A D | StateTables.h | 74 #define LE_STATE_PATIENCE_INIT() le_uint32 le_patience_count = LE_STATE_PATIENCE_COUNT 90 le_uint32 nClasses; 91 le_uint32 classTableOffset; 92 le_uint32 stateArrayOffset; 93 le_uint32 entryTableOffset;
|
H A D | ExtensionSubtables.cpp | 44 #define READ_LONG(code) (le_uint32)((SWAPW(*(le_uint16*)&code) << 16) + SWAPW(*(((le_uint16*)&code) + 1))) 47 le_uint32 ExtensionSubtable::process(const LEReferenceTo<ExtensionSubtable> &thisRef, 59 le_uint32 extOffset = READ_LONG(extensionOffset);
|
H A D | SingleSubstitutionSubtables.h | 50 le_uint32 process(const LEReferenceTo<SingleSubstitutionSubtable> &base, GlyphIterator *glyphIterator, LEErrorCode &success, const LEGlyphFilter *filter = NULL) const; 57 le_uint32 process(const LEReferenceTo<SingleSubstitutionFormat1Subtable> &base, GlyphIterator *glyphIterator, LEErrorCode &success, const LEGlyphFilter *filter = NULL) const; 65 le_uint32 process(const LEReferenceTo<SingleSubstitutionFormat2Subtable> &base, GlyphIterator *glyphIterator, LEErrorCode &success, const LEGlyphFilter *filter = NULL) const;
|
H A D | StateTableProcessor2.h | 69 le_uint32 nClasses; 70 le_uint32 classTableOffset; 71 le_uint32 stateArrayOffset; 72 le_uint32 entryTableOffset;
|
H A D | OpenTypeTables.h | 49 typedef le_uint32 fixed32; 52 typedef le_uint32 FeatureMask;
|
H A D | LEStandalone.h | 79 typedef unsigned long le_uint32; typedef 82 typedef unsigned int le_uint32; typedef 89 typedef le_uint32 UChar32;
|
H A D | LigatureSubstProc2.h | 83 le_uint32 ligActionOffset; 84 le_uint32 componentOffset; 85 le_uint32 ligatureOffset;
|
H A D | SinglePositioningSubtables.h | 51 le_uint32 process(const LEReferenceTo<SinglePositioningSubt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const; 59 le_uint32 process(const LEReferenceTo<SinglePositioningFormat1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const; 68 le_uint32 process(const LEReferenceTo<SinglePositioningFormat2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const;
|
H A D | ContextualGlyphSubstitution.h | 54 le_uint32 perGlyphTableOffset; // no more substitution tables
|
H A D | LEGlyphStorage.h | 95 le_uint32 *fAuxData; 188 void getGlyphs(le_uint32 glyphs[], le_uint32 extraBits, LEErrorCode &success) const; 289 void getAuxData(le_uint32 auxData[], LEErrorCode &success) const; 326 le_uint32 getAuxData(le_int32 glyphIndex, LEErrorCode &success) const; 392 void moveGlyph(le_int32 fromPosition, le_int32 toPosition, le_uint32 marker); 463 void setAuxData(le_int32 glyphIndex, le_uint32 auxData, LEErrorCode &success);
|
H A D | GlyphIterator.h | 64 le_bool next(le_uint32 delta = 1); 65 le_bool prev(le_uint32 delta = 1); 101 le_bool filterGlyph(le_uint32 index) const; 103 le_bool nextInternal(le_uint32 delta = 1); 104 le_bool prevInternal(le_uint32 delta = 1);
|
H A D | LookupProcessor.h | 65 le_uint32 applyLookupTable(const LEReferenceTo<LookupTable> &lookupTable,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 67 le_uint32 applySingleLookup(le_uint16 lookupTableIndex,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 69 virtual le_uint32 applySubtable(const LEReferenceTo<LookupSubtable> &lookupSubtable, le_uint16 subtableType, 96 le_uint32 lookupSelectCount; 99 le_uint32 lookupOrderCount;
|
H A D | ContextualGlyphSubstProc2.h | 78 TTGlyphID lookup(le_uint32 offset, LEGlyphID gid, LEErrorCode &success); 81 LEReferenceToArrayOf<le_uint32> perGlyphTable;
|
H A D | ContextualSubstSubtables.h | 82 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 90 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 119 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 155 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 161 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 169 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 204 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const; 246 le_uint32 process(const LookupProcessor *lookupProcessor,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ode& success) const;
|
H A D | LESwaps.h | 136 static le_uint32 swapLong(le_uint32 value)
|
H A D | OpenTypeUtilities.h | 60 static le_int32 search(le_uint32 value, const le_uint32 array[], le_int32 count);
|
H A D | AlternateSubstSubtables.h | 61 le_uint32 process(const LEReferenceTo<AlternateSubstitutionSubtable> &base, GlyphIterator *glyphIterator, LEErrorCode &success, const LEGlyphFilter *filter = NULL) const;
|
H A D | AttachmentPosnSubtables.h | 57 le_uint32 process(GlyphIterator *glyphIterator) const;
|
H A D | ContextualGlyphInsertion.h | 54 le_uint32 insertionTableOffset;
|
H A D | CursiveAttachmentSubtables.h | 60 le_uint32 process(const LEReferenceTo<CursiveAttachmentSubt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const;
|
H A D | MultipleSubstSubtables.h | 60 le_uint32 process(const LETableReference &base, GlyphIterator *glyphIterator, LEErrorCode& success, const LEGlyphFilter *filter = NULL) const;
|
H A D | PairPositioningSubtables.h | 69 le_uint32 process(const LEReferenceTo<PairPositioningSubt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const; 77 le_uint32 process(const LEReferenceTo<PairPositioningFormat1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const; 107 le_uint32 process(const LEReferenceTo<PairPositioningFormat2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const;
|
H A D | SinglePositioningSubtables.cpp | 43 le_uint32 SinglePositioningSubtable::process(const LEReferenceTo<SinglePositioningSubt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const 69 le_uint32 SinglePositioningFormat1Subtable::process(const LEReferenceTo<SinglePositioningFormat1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const 86 le_uint32 SinglePositioningFormat2Subtable::process(const LEReferenceTo<SinglePositioningFormat2Subtable> &base, GlyphIterator *glyphIterator, const LEFontInstance *fontInstance, LEErrorCode &success) const
|